"This is a new brewery for me and I decided to pick some of there offerings up on a recent trip to a local packy in Carrollton, GA. Aroma is interesting in that it is not as banana-clovey as some German hefeweizens are and this sample offers some sour note on the nose with some strong weak malt and yeast coming through. Appearance is a golden-yellow in color when held to the light with nice cloudy notes with a full and frothy head that dissipates a little too quickly for me and is a bleach-white in color and leaves fuzzy lacing. Mouthfeel is light-bodied and smooth with some complex tartness as well as some malty character with a palate that is wet-like and clean. Flavor is some sourness as well as some tartness with not much banana esters with some sweetness with an aftertaste that is clean but a bit dull around the edges with a finish that is clean, wet, and pretty tasty with some spicey clove on the back end; decent hefe here but not as solid as one truly German in soul.
